Output fbec2efee612260e25ad3ab798eeca30b6e071d805743890d69cda3e99bd2fce:51

value
22194388
script pubkey
OP_0 OP_PUSHBYTES_20 d8fa4e6695cf8b98499c05575550a1e883e95078
address
bc1qmrayue54e79esjvuq4t4259pazp7j5rcf77wft
transaction
fbec2efee612260e25ad3ab798eeca30b6e071d805743890d69cda3e99bd2fce
confirmations
1375
spent
true